There is a positive outlook for the respiratory market over the next five years, which will experience a sustained period of growth driven by the expansion of sales in existing classes, the launch of major new products, and the results from several landmark studies. However, the patent expiries of two leading products, Singulair and Seretide, will see growth flatten from the turn of the decade.

    Global asthma/COPD sales should grow to $23 billion by 2014, with inhaled corticosteroid/long-acting bronchodilator combinations set to be the leading class by value in 2014, followed by leukotriene antagonists, and anticholinergics.

    AstraZeneca's Symbicort should become the top-selling brand in the global market, driven by the approval of Symbicort Maintenance and Reliever therapy (SMART) in the EU, the launch of Symbicort in the US market, and the impact of generic competition on Advair/Seretide sales.

    Four new launches are expected within the next five years, the most significant being Symbicort in the US and the launch of novel ICS/LABA combination products which will need a strong differentiation profile, based on improved safety, flexible dosing, or once-daily dosing to compete with Advair/Seretide and Symbicort.
